So erhalten Sie das Fensterhandle: 1. Verwenden Sie auf der Windows-Plattform die Windows-API-Funktion, um das Fensterhandle abzurufen. 2. Verwenden Sie in Python die Drittanbieterbibliothek pywin32, um die Windows-API-Funktion aufzurufen, um das Fensterhandle zu erhalten 3. In Java können Sie die Methode getWindows der Klasse java.awt.Window verwenden, um die Handles aller Fenster abzurufen. 4. Auf der Linux-Plattform können Sie die vom X Window System bereitgestellten Funktionen verwenden.
In verschiedenen Programmiersprachen und Betriebssystemen kann die Methode zum Abrufen des Fensterhandles unterschiedlich sein. Hier sind einige gängige Methoden:
Verwenden Sie auf der Windows-Plattform Windows-API-Funktionen, um das Fensterhandle zu erhalten. In C++ können Sie beispielsweise die Funktionen FindWindow, FindWindowEx, EnumWindows usw. verwenden, um das Fensterhandle abzurufen.
In Python können Sie die Drittanbieterbibliothek pywin32 verwenden, um die Windows-API-Funktion aufzurufen und das Fensterhandle zu erhalten. Verwenden Sie beispielsweise win32gui.FindWindow, win32gui.FindWindowEx, win32gui.EnumWindows und andere Funktionen.
In Java können Sie die Methode getWindows der Klasse java.awt.Window verwenden, um die Handles aller Fenster abzurufen.
Auf der Linux-Plattform können Sie die vom X Window System bereitgestellten Funktionen verwenden, um das Fensterhandle abzurufen. In der Sprache C können Sie beispielsweise die Funktion XQueryTree verwenden, um das Fensterhandle abzurufen.
Es ist zu beachten, dass verschiedene Betriebssysteme und Programmiersprachen unterschiedliche Methoden zum Abrufen des Fensterhandles haben können. Die spezifische Methode kann entsprechend der tatsächlichen Situation ausgewählt werden.
Das obige ist der detaillierte Inhalt vonWelche Methoden gibt es, um das Fensterhandle zu erhalten?. Für weitere Informationen folgen Sie bitte anderen verwandten Artikeln auf der PHP chinesischen Website!